Deltoid Muscle: Anatomy and Function

Before diving into the specifics of origin and insertion, let's briefly review the deltoid's overall structure and function. The deltoid is responsible for a wide range of shoulder movements, including abduction (raising the arm away from the body), flexion (raising the arm forward), extension (moving the arm backward), and medial (internal) and lateral (external) rotation. This versatility stems from its unique arrangement of muscle fibers and its broad attachment points. It is further subdivided into three distinct parts: anterior, middle, and posterior deltoids, each with its own specific origin and insertion, contributing to its complex functionality.

Origin of the Deltoid Muscle

The deltoid muscle's origin is spread across a significant area of the shoulder girdle, contributing to its powerful actions. The three heads of the deltoid – anterior, middle, and posterior – each originate from different locations:

Anterior Deltoid Origin

  • Lateral third of the clavicle: The anterior fibers originate from the outer portion of the clavicle (collarbone).

Middle Deltoid Origin

  • Acromion process of the scapula: The middle fibers originate from the acromion, the bony projection forming the highest point of the shoulder.

Posterior Deltoid Origin

  • Spine of the scapula: The posterior fibers originate from the spine of the scapula, a bony ridge running across the back of the scapula (shoulder blade).

Insertion of the Deltoid Muscle

All three heads of the deltoid muscle converge and insert at a common point:

  • Deltoid tuberosity of the humerus: This is a roughened area on the lateral aspect (outside) of the humerus (upper arm bone).

This shared insertion point allows for coordinated movement of the arm. The different origins, however, allow each head to contribute to specific movements.

Deltoid Muscle Actions: A Breakdown by Head

The precise actions of the deltoid are complex and depend on the head engaged and whether the movement is against resistance or gravity. Understanding the unique contribution of each head is important for exercise planning and injury analysis:

  • Anterior Deltoid: Primarily involved in shoulder flexion (raising the arm forward) and medial (internal) rotation.

  • Middle Deltoid: Primarily involved in shoulder abduction (raising the arm to the side).

  • Posterior Deltoid: Primarily involved in shoulder extension (moving the arm backward) and lateral (external) rotation.

Clinical Significance: Injuries and Conditions

Knowledge of the deltoid's origin and insertion is essential in diagnosing and treating various shoulder injuries. Tears, strains, and impingement syndromes often affect this muscle, leading to pain, weakness, and reduced range of motion. Accurate identification of the affected area helps in guiding treatment strategies, such as physical therapy, medication, or even surgery.
